Transaction 93f2452aa04621546544c8622da5282505acef71cfa382b091323111044024e3

2 Input
2 Outputs
  • 93f2452aa04621546544c8622da5282505acef71cfa382b091323111044024e3:0
  • value  185860
    address  1Kx3p5x2XBaUDTdUJZEDJh2QwfM6fr9vde
  • 93f2452aa04621546544c8622da5282505acef71cfa382b091323111044024e3:1
  • value  1021504
    address  3G7iwC9PQaBuoBu4K2rTZSUFVJLrsgVWE3